"The default pcAnywhere port numbers are 5631 (DataPort or TCP) and 5632 (StatusPort or UDP)." -> From norton's web site.
Based on this, you will need to open two ports on the firewall, one TCP and one UDP and have traffic from those ports routed to the machine which you need to access with the appropriate ports. Note that on the e-smith server one would noe necesairly need to open those ports, but for ease of use it would be better. Again, the ipmasqadm tool comes in handy. Downlaod the rpm and install it, and read the man page. Personally, I modified the cgi script from the e-smith web admin system to allow me, or rather the people at home when I am not here to easily "turn on" or "turn off" pcanywhere, that is, open and redirect the appropriate ports, and close them again to block all traffic again, a good idea for security reasons. Also be awawhere that if u do run pcanywhere to make damn sure you have it password protected, or else you might find some people port scanning you, noticing those ports are open and do god knows what to the pc. Cheers,
Steve